The outgoing Inspector General of Police, Dr George Akuffo Dampare, was not present when President met with the heads of various state security institutions who have been relieved of their posts, on Monday, March 17, 2025.
In a post shared around 3 PM on Monday, the president specifically mentioned three out of the four security chiefs whom he has replaced following his election and inauguration. "I am grateful to have met with outgoing service commanders Isaac Kofi Egyir (Prisons), Julius A.
Kuunuor (Fire), and Kwame Asuah Takyi (Immigration) to express my sincere appreciation for their dedicated service to Ghana," the president wrote.
In March 2025, President initiated a significant overhaul of Ghana's security sector leadership since taking office for his second term on January 7, 2025.
